Volumetric feeders provide even discharge of hard-to-handle material
A trash incineration utility depends on feeders with flexible vinyl hoppers to evenly discharge the limestone necessary to reduce sulfur dioxide emissions.
The Montgomery County Solid Waste Management Department operates two trash incineration plants that burn nonhazardous household, commercial, and industrial trash from the Dayton, Ohio, metropolitan area. The plants operate 24 hours a day, 7 days a week.
